A system and method to authenticate a user utilizing a time-varying
auxiliary code. The code may be appended to a fixed password, but that is
not required. The code is generated by a central electronic
authentication system. The user retrieves it manually using a fungible
communications device such as a telephone or a computer connected to the
Internet. The user must learn the code because he inputs it manually,
thereby authenticating himself. The present invention performs the same
function as inventions with tokens, that is, it provides an extension to
the PIN or password, but it eliminates the token and the synchronization
required with such a token.